Beneath the surface of what medicine has long called a diagnosable moment, a precancerous transformation of the esophagus may have already been quietly underway for decades. New research into Barrett Esophagus suggests that the cellular changes preceding esophageal cancer begin far earlier than clinical tools can currently detect, exposing a profound gap between when disease starts and when it is seen. This finding invites a reckoning with one of medicine's oldest tensions: the difference between the origin of illness and the moment we first name it.
